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/289.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 如何使用PIL将图像从HSV转换为RGB?_Python_Python Imaging Library - Fatal编程技术网

Python 如何使用PIL将图像从HSV转换为RGB?

Python 如何使用PIL将图像从HSV转换为RGB?,python,python-imaging-library,Python,Python Imaging Library,我一直在尝试将HSV颜色空间中的图像转换为RGB,但所有解决方案都进行单像素(元组)转换。比如说, import colorsys colorsys.hsv_to_rgb(0.5, 0.5, 0.4) 有没有一种矢量化的方法可以将整个HSV图像一次性转换为RGB?如果您有PIL图像,可以使用这种方法。例如 image = Image.new("HSV",(10, 10)) rgb_image = image.convert(mode="RGB") 什么程序/功能创建了HSV图像?我的意思是,

我一直在尝试将HSV颜色空间中的图像转换为RGB,但所有解决方案都进行单像素(元组)转换。比如说,

import colorsys
colorsys.hsv_to_rgb(0.5, 0.5, 0.4)

有没有一种矢量化的方法可以将整个HSV图像一次性转换为RGB?

如果您有PIL图像,可以使用这种方法。例如

image = Image.new("HSV",(10, 10))
rgb_image = image.convert(mode="RGB")

什么程序/功能创建了HSV图像?我的意思是,你从哪里得到的?我有密集的光流梯度,我正在转换成HSV图像。